Tylomelania carbo is a species of freshwater snail with an operculum, an aquatic gastropod mollusk in the family Pachychilidae.
The sister group (the closest relative) of Tylomelania carbo is Tylomelania toradjarum.[2]
This species occurs in lake Poso, Central Sulawesi, Indonesia.[1] The type locality is lake Poso.[1]
The width of the shell is up to 10.5 mm.[1] The height of the shell is up to 16.5 mm.[1] The width of the aperture is 6 mm.[1] The height of the aperture is 9 mm.[1]
The length of the radula can be up to 21.5 mm.[2]
